Another one that I noticed. The dist structure is very simple rn, so unlikely to run into orphaned files as you're emitting a single built artifact which wil be overwritten on build, but I always prefer to do clean builds as "hygiene". I had a dirty dist personally after local development and testing some things, as an example. Alternatives could be to create a `clean` script with cross platform `rimraf dist`
